Fig. 1 shows the stream of the video data real-time processing method according to an embodiment of the invention for realizing scene rendering Cheng Tu.As shown in figure 1, realize that the video data real-time processing method of scene rendering specifically comprises the following steps:
Step S101, real-time image acquisition collecting device is captured and/or the video recorded in comprising special object Current frame image;Or the current frame image that special object is included in currently played video is obtained in real time.
Image capture device illustrates by taking mobile terminal as an example in the present embodiment.Get mobile terminal camera in real time Current frame image when current frame image in recorded video or shooting video.Due to the present invention to special object at Reason, therefore only obtain the current frame image comprising special object during acquisition current frame image.Except real-time image acquisition collecting device Outside the captured and/or video recorded, it can also obtain in real time current comprising special object in currently played video Two field picture.
Step S102, scene cut processing is carried out to current frame image, current frame image is obtained and is directed to special object Foreground image.
Special object, such as human body are contained in current frame image.Scene cut processing is carried out to current frame image, mainly Special object is split from current frame image, obtains the foreground image that current frame image is directed to special object, before this Scape image can only include special object.
When carrying out scene cut processing to current frame image, deep learning method can be utilized.Deep learning is machine It is a kind of based on the method that data are carried out with representative learning in study.Observation (such as piece image) can use various ways Represent, such as the vector of each pixel intensity value, or be more abstractively expressed as a series of sides, the region etc. of given shape.And make It is easier with some specific method for expressing from example learning task (for example, recognition of face or human facial expression recognition).Such as profit Scene cut can be carried out to current frame image, obtain including the foreground image of human body with human body segmentation's method of deep learning.
Step S103, drawing three-dimensional scene background figure.
During drawing three-dimensional scene background figure, the picture of two dimension can be plotted as to the scene background figure of three-dimensional.Can during drafting The picture of two dimension is plotted as to the scene graph of three-dimensional in a manner of using such as to the picture modeling of two dimension.Specific method for drafting can be with Using any method that two-dimension picture is plotted as to tri-dimensional picture, do not limit herein.Three-dimensional scenic Background can use such as Three-dimensional seabed scene background figure, three-dimensional volcano scene background figure etc..
Step S104, three-dimensional scenic Background and foreground image are subjected to fusion treatment, obtain the figure after present frame processing Picture.
The foreground image for being directed to special object that three-dimensional scenic Background and dividing processing are obtained carries out fusion treatment, So that three-dimensional scenic Background is more really merged with foreground image, the image after present frame processing is obtained.To make three Dimension scene background figure and foreground image can be merged preferably, and when carrying out dividing processing to current frame image, segmentation is obtained The edge of perspective process carry out translucent processing, the edge of special object is obscured, preferably to merge.
Step S105, the image after present frame is handled cover the video data after former current frame image is handled.
Image after being handled using present frame directly overrides former current frame image, the video after directly can be processed Data.Meanwhile the user of recording can also be immediately seen the image after present frame processing.
In the image after obtaining present frame processing, the image after can present frame be handled directly covers former present frame figure Picture.Speed during covering, typically completed within 1/24 second.For a user, because the time of covering treatment is relative Short, human eye is not discovered significantly, i.e., human eye does not perceive the process that the former current frame image in video data is capped.This During video data of the sample after follow-up display processing, shoot and/or record equivalent to one side and/or during playing video data, one Side real-time display does not feel as the display effect that two field picture in video data covers for the video data after processing, user Fruit.
Step S106, the video data after display processing.
After video data after being handled, it can be shown in real time, after user can directly be seen that processing Video data display effect.

Step S206, according to the terrain information of height map drawing three-dimensional scene background figure.
Height map is the picture of two dimension, typically by black, white and between 254 kinds of gradual change gray scales generated.According to height Degree is desired to make money or profit with such as gray scale value-based algorithm, fractal interpolation algorithm, Diamond-Square algorithm scheduling algorithm drawing three-dimensional scene background figures Terrain information.When drawing terrain information, color is got over for the Terrain Elevation of the three-dimensional scenic Background of the position correspondence of white Height, conversely, color is lower for the Terrain Elevation of the three-dimensional scenic Background of the position correspondence of black.
Step S207, according to the terrain information of three-dimensional scenic Background, three-dimensional scenic Background is carried out at texture mapping Reason.
According to the terrain information of the three-dimensional scenic Background of drafting, texture mapping processing is carried out to three-dimensional conclusion of the business Background. Such as sand ground landform, the texture mapping processing that corresponding can carry out sand ground.Carried out during texture mapping processing according to different landform The processing of corresponding texture mapping, during processing, to make three-dimensional scenic Background truer, multitexture stick picture disposing can be carried out. Such as carry out the texture mapping processing of the sandy sand ground of multiple difference.
After the processing of texture spy figure is carried out, OpenGL mapping technologies can be utilized, so as to generate the three of vivid effect Tie up scene background figure.
Step S208, in the default statically and/or dynamically effect textures of part designated area addition of three-dimensional scenic Background.
, can also be in three-dimensional scenic Background to make three-dimensional scenic Background not only include simple background display effect The default statically and/or dynamically effect textures of part designated area addition.As referred in three-dimensional seabed scene background figure in its part Such as dynamic pasture and water effect textures, bubble effect textures, seabed coral reef statically and/or dynamically effect can be set by determining region Textures, so that the display effect of whole three-dimensional scenic Background is more true to nature.
Step S209, according to positional information of the special object in current frame image and the foreground image specified in three dimensional field The depth information of scape Background, three-dimensional scenic Background and foreground image are subjected to fusion treatment, after obtaining present frame processing Image.
Positional information of the special object of acquisition in current frame image, specifically includes special object in current frame image Position where upper and lower and left and right.Three-dimensional scenic Background reflects the three-dimensional relationship of top to bottom, left and right, front and rear in figure.By three Tie up scene background figure and foreground image carries out fusion treatment, particular location of the foreground image in three-dimensional scenic Background includes upper Under, left and right, front and rear position.According to positional information of the special object in current frame image foreground image can be determined in three-dimensional Upper and lower in scene background figure, left and right particular location.According to specified foreground image three-dimensional scenic Background depth information, Foreground image particular location front and rear in three-dimensional scenic Background can be determined, and then determines foreground image in three-dimensional scenic Particular location in Background, three-dimensional scenic Background and foreground image can be subjected to fusion treatment, obtain present frame processing Image afterwards.Positional information of the special object in current frame image according to the distance of special object and image capture device not Together, positional information of the special object got in current frame image also can be different.But foreground image is in three-dimensional scenic background The depth information of figure is the front and back position information specified, and does not change with positional information of the special object in current frame image and becomes Change.
Step S210, the display pattern of foreground image is adjusted according to distance.
According to the distance between at least two key points with symmetric relation being calculated, the face of foreground image is adjusted The display patterns such as color, tone, lighting effect, brightness.Specifically, according to distance, it can be realized that foreground image is in three-dimensional scenic When position in Background such as three-dimensional scenic Background is seabed scene background figure, color is general more based on blueness but different The blueness of position is also slightly different.According to the color of the corresponding adjustment foreground image of distance, to reach seemingly specific in display Object is really in seabed.
Step S211, either statically or dynamically effect textures are added in the part designated area of the image after present frame is handled.
The part designated area of image after present frame processing, can also add either statically or dynamically effect textures.The effect Fruit textures mutually echo with three-dimensional scenic Background, so that the display effect of three-dimensional scenic Background is more true to nature.As three-dimensional scenic is carried on the back When scape figure is seabed scene background figure, travelling seabed can be added in the part designated area of the image after present frame processing The either statically or dynamically effect textures of biology.
Step S212, tone processing, photo-irradiation treatment and/or brightness processed are carried out to the image after present frame processing.
To make the effect of the image after present frame processing more natural true, figure can be carried out to the image after present frame processing As processing.Image procossing can include carrying out tone processing, photo-irradiation treatment, brightness processed etc. to the image after present frame processing. When such as three-dimensional scenic background being seabed scene background figure, it can be adjusted according to the different depth position information of seabed scene background figure Its whole colouring information so that the color intensity of sea water in seabed is closer as seabed depth change produces to be become with the color of nature seawater Change, it is more blue in the color of deeper position seawater.The photo-irradiation treatment of grating can also be increased in the image after present frame processing Effect, simulate sunlight seawater, the visual experience of seabed refracted light.
